    The DWA-160 looks pretty much like its predecessor, DWA-140, except that it white in color and has support for 5Ghz band. Both the DWA-160 and DWA-140 are OEM from RAlink’s RT2870 so it is perfectly fine to use the drivers from RAlink’s website.

    Did a wireless throughput test using the follow equipments:

    • DWA-160
    • HP EliteBook 2530p
    • DIR-855
    • DNS-343
    • DNS-323

    The test environment

    Files of size greater than 4GB will be placed on the NAS (DNS-343, DNS-323) attached to the DIR-855. DWA-160 will be set up on the HP EliteBook 2530p using RAlink’s drivers for RT2870.

    The HP EliteBook 2530p will be placed 5 meters from the DIR-855.
